开源的应用容器引擎

修改docker容器端口映射的方法

修改docker容器端口映射的方法
操作步骤是:1) 停止容器2) 停止docker服务(systemctl stop docker)3) 修改这个容器的hostconfig.json文件中的端口(原帖有人提到,如果config.v2.json里面也记录了端口,也要修改)cd /var/lib/docker/containers/3322882c783111d99cfc02640a……继续阅读 »

sunny5156 6个月前 (12-04) 166浏览 0评论0个赞

Mac OS X 安装 Docker

Mac OS X 安装 Docker
你可以使用 Boot2Docker 来安装 Docker ,然后在命令行运行 docker。如果你对命令行比较熟悉或者你打算在 Github 上贡献 Docker 项目,那么你就可以选择此安装方式。或者,你可以使用 Kitematic , 它是一款图形界面的应用程序(GUI),你可以通过图形界面来轻松的设置 Docker 和运行容器。 Command-……继续阅读 »

sunny5156 1年前 (2017-12-26) 450浏览 0评论0个赞

docker常用命令详解[下]

docker常用命令详解[下]
1. 开启/停止/重启container(start/stop/restart) 容器可以通过run新建一个来运行,也可以重新start已经停止的container,但start不能够再指定容器启动时运行的指令,因为docker只能有一个前台进程。容器stop(或Ctrl+D)时,会在保存当前容器的状态之后退出,下次start时保有上次关闭时更改。而且每次……继续阅读 »

sunny5156 2年前 (2017-04-26) 391浏览 0评论0个赞

docker常用命令详解[上]

docker常用命令详解[上]
本文只记录Docker命令在大部分情境下的使用,如果想了解每一个选项的细节,请参考官方文档,这里只作为自己以后的备忘记录下来。 根据自己的理解,总的来说分为以下几种: 容器生命周期管理 — docker [run|start|stop|restart|kill|rm|pause|unpause] 容器操作运维 — docker [ps|inspect……继续阅读 »

sunny5156 2年前 (2017-04-26) 418浏览 0评论0个赞

Docker: 如何修改 Docker 的镜像存储位置

Docker: 如何修改 Docker 的镜像存储位置
我用的阿里云的服务器, 但是系统盘只有20G, 默认 Docker 的镜像文件是安装在/var/lib 目录下的, 这样的话我根本装不了太多的镜像… 这个必须得改改…搜了下, 解决方案如下: 方案1, 使用参数-g 来修改 Docker 的镜像存储文件夹.修改方法如下:在 Ubuntu/Debian 系统下:编辑 /etc……继续阅读 »

sunny5156 2年前 (2017-04-07) 450浏览 0评论0个赞

DockerFly docker web管理

DockerFly docker web管理
Dockerfly是基于 Docker1.12+ (Docker API 1.24+) 开发出Docker 管理工具,提供里最基本的基于 Docker 的管理功能,目的是能够方便广大Docker初学者以及 Docker 管理员能够快速的进行Docker 容器的管理和维护。使用 dockerfly 可以管理docker中 swarm、container、……继续阅读 »

sunny5156 2年前 (2017-03-01) 741浏览 0评论0个赞

Alpine Linux,一个只有5M的Docker镜像

Alpine Linux,一个只有5M的Docker镜像
  简介 Alpine Linux Docker镜像基于Alpine Linux操作系统,后者是一个面向安全的轻型Linux发行版。不同于通常Linux发行版,Alpine Linux采用了musl libc和busybox以减小系统的体积和运行时资源消耗。在保持瘦身的同时,Alpine Linux还提供了自己的包管理工具apk,可以在其……继续阅读 »

sunny5156 2年前 (2017-03-01) 832浏览 0评论0个赞

Docker镜像 导入导出 迁移

Docker镜像 导入导出 迁移
Docker 背后的驱动力之一就是通过所有的 Docker 使服务器 能创建一个一致的环境,并且能创建一个能运行在任何 Docker 服务器上的合适的模板或是镜像。 因此,Docker 能非常完美的支持,能非常容易的导出一个正在运行的容器,并且重新导入另外一台 Docker 服务器。 让我们假设一下,例如这个示例,你有一个你将移动到另外一台服务器去的正在……继续阅读 »

sunny5156 3年前 (2016-12-02) 894浏览 0评论0个赞

使用 supervisor 管理进程

使用 supervisor 管理进程
Supervisor (http://supervisord.org) 是一个用 Python 写的进程管理工具,可以很方便的用来启动、重启、关闭进程(不仅仅是 Python 进程)。除了对单个进程的控制,还可以同时启动、关闭多个进程,比如很不幸的服务器出问题导致所有应用程序都被杀死,此时可以用 supervisor 同时启动所有应用程序而不是一个一个地敲命……继续阅读 »

sunny5156 3年前 (2016-05-26) 979浏览 0评论0个赞